With the spread of the first confirmed COVID-19 mutant virus in the UK, the government has decided to mandate the submission of negative PCR confirmations for all foreigners entering the country.



The Korea Centers for Disease Control and Prevention explained, "It is mandatory for all foreigners to submit a negative PCR confirmation letter when entering Korea."



Accordingly, foreigners entering Korea via flight starting on the 8th must submit a negative PCR confirmation issued within 72 hours from the departure date.



The PCR negative confirmation was first introduced in July of last year for entrants from some countries subject to strengthening quarantine, and on December 28 of last year, submission of the negative PCR was mandatory for all entrants from the UK and South Africa.
